What to Do Right Now If You're Locked Out

Before you try anything yourself, take a breath. Attempting to force a door open with a coat hanger, a wedge, or any improvised tool risks scratching paint, bending door frames, or damaging weatherstripping — repairs that often cost far more than a professional lockout call. The right first steps are simple: confirm no other door or window is unlocked, check whether a trusted person nearby has your spare key, and if you're in an unfamiliar spot in Putnam County, move to a well-lit, safe location while you wait for help. Then call a qualified locksmith who can reach you quickly.

What you should never do is leave children or pets inside a locked vehicle, especially during Carmel Hamlet's humid summers or cold winters when interior temperatures can become dangerous within minutes. If a child or animal is trapped, call 911 immediately — that situation goes beyond a standard car lockout and requires emergency services first.

Vehicles and Lock Types We Handle for Car Lockout Assistance

Modern vehicles present a much wider range of lock configurations than they did even ten years ago. Our technicians are trained on traditional mechanical lock cylinders, multi-point locking rods, electronic actuators, and the push-button or proximity-key systems found on many late-model sedans, SUVs, and trucks. We regularly assist drivers of domestic, European, and Asian vehicles throughout the Carmel Hamlet area and across Putnam County, and our mobile units carry the tooling needed for the vast majority of configurations without a return trip.

Beyond standard door locks, we also assist with locked trunks, locked glove compartments, and situations where a key has broken off inside the lock cylinder itself. In those cases, the broken key must be extracted before entry is possible — a delicate process that requires the right tools and a steady hand. If the cylinder is damaged in the process of a self-rescue attempt, we can assess whether a replacement is needed and provide a clear quote before proceeding. Car lockout assistance doesn't always end at the door; we see the job through completely.

Factors That Determine Your Car Lockout Service Quote

We believe every customer deserves to know exactly what they'll pay before work begins — no surprises, no add-ons at the end of the call. The final price for a car lockout service call is shaped by several honest variables. Vehicle type plays a significant role: luxury vehicles with sophisticated electronic locking systems or reinforced door frames may require more specialized tools and additional time compared to a standard sedan. Time of day also factors in — late-night and early-morning calls involve different operational demands than a midday lockout. Travel distance matters too; a call from a remote area of Putnam County outside our immediate Carmel Hamlet base takes longer to reach, and that's reflected transparently in the quote. Finally, if additional work is needed — such as extracting a broken key or addressing a damaged lock actuator — those parts and labor are itemized clearly before we proceed. Our goal is a quote you can say yes to with full confidence, not one that shifts after the job is done.
